Going Big on the Blue Tablet: copyright Pump Scams
A disconcerting trend is gaining traction within the copyright market: the "blue pill" scheme. These misleading copyright boost schemes lure unsuspecting investors with promises of substantial returns, often utilizing a narrative of awakening – a nod to the "red pill" concept popularized by the film *The Matrix*. The scheme typically involves strategically inflating the price of a obscure copyright token, encouraging early traders to buy in, only for the organizers to offload their holdings at a elevated price, leaving remaining investors holding valueless assets. Watchdogs are increasingly warning against these highly damaging ventures, emphasizing the importance of thorough research and due caution before allocating capital into the copyright.
